A second place finish for Will Brown in the final race of the Superloop Adelaide 500 today has seen the gun 21 year old make it three from three podiums in the opening round of the 2020 Dunlop Super2 Series.
Starting third on the grid behind Brodie Kostecki and Thomas Randle,  Brown made the most of a costly Kostecki error on lap three. Kostecki went wide on Turn 4, running down the escape road allowing Randle to take the lead with Will close behind.

Brown battled well to maintain his position for the rest of the race, finishing just 2.3575 seconds behind Randle and securing  overall third place in the Championship after the first round on 264 points, Just 20 points behind Randle (284) and 22 behind leader Kostecki (286).

“I said if we came in this weekend and walked away on the podium we’d be pretty happy so I can’t complain at all,” said Brown.

“’The  car felt a lot better today, so I am really happy with it. I think we ended the weekend off alright. I didn’t have my helmet fan or my cool suit working, so it got really hot toward the end, but we were definitely better. Thomas didn’t get away from us like previous races, so that showed the improvement.”

Brown’s opening round under the new team of Erebus Motorsport Image Racing has proven to be an encouraging start for the young Queenslander. Brown believes the competition in the Dunlop Super2 Series will see some epic battles this year, especially between himself, Kostecki and Randle.

“We showed it in P1 this year that we are a second faster than last year, so it definitely hasn’t got any less competitive, especially with these guys sitting here.

“Brodie won a few races last year and Tom won a few as well so its just as competitive as last year. We are all battling for the title and everyone wants it.
